Cost of Land Regrading in Tallahassee
Land regrading is an essential process for many property owners in Tallahassee, FL, whether for improving drainage, preparing for construction, or enhancing the landscape. Understanding the costs involved can help you budget more effectively and make informed decisions.
Factors Affecting Cost
- Size of the Area: Larger areas generally require more time and resources, increasing the overall cost.
- Soil Type: Hard or rocky soil may necessitate specialized equipment and labor, raising expenses.
- Slope of the Land: Steeper slopes often require more extensive work to achieve the desired grade.
- Accessibility: Difficult-to-reach areas may involve additional labor and machinery, impacting costs.
- Permits and Regulations: Compliance with local regulations and obtaining necessary permits can add to the cost.
- Labor Costs: Local labor rates in Tallahassee, FL can vary, influencing the final price.
- Equipment Rental: The need for specialized machinery can affect the total cost, depending on rental rates.
Average Costs for Common Tasks
Task | Average Cost (Tallahassee, FL) |
---|---|
Basic Land Regrading | $1,000 - $3,000 |
Extensive Land Regrading | $3,000 - $8,000 |
Soil Testing | $300 - $700 |
Erosion Control Measures | $500 - $1,500 |
Permit Fees | $100 - $500 |
Drainage System Installation | $1,500 - $5,000 |
